From Rembrandt to Vermeer: Life in Painting

From April 9 to August 24, 2025, the H’ART Museum celebrates the 750th anniversary of Amsterdam with the exhibition "From Rembrandt to Vermeer," bringing together for the first time in the city eighteen works by Rembrandt alongside masterpieces by Vermeer, Frans Hals, Jan Steen, and other 17th-century masters.

Through 75 paintings, the exhibition offers a vibrant look at Dutch society of the time, highlighting daily life and the role of women.

A special highlight will be the presentation of a rare Vermeer painting, restored for the occasion, and a work by Maria Schalcken, one of the few female painters of her time.
